WebJul 13, 2014 · File-level storage is the predominant storage technology used on hard drives, network-attached storage (NAS) systems and similar storage systems. File … WebOct 8, 2024 · File Storage vs Block Storage. File storage is a way of storing data in a hierarchical system. Files hold the data in the same format in which it was created or received. File storage can be accessed using Server Message Block (SMB) in Windows or Network File System (NFS) protocol on Unix/Linux. WebNetwork Attached Storage (NAS) is a file-level storage architecture where 1 or more servers with dedicated disks store data and share it with many clients connected to a network. NAS is 1 of the 3 main storage … WebUsually, a NAS provides file-level access. That means if you need to change just a single character inside of an entire file, you need to rewrite the entire file onto that NAS device. A SAN is a Storage Area Network, and this is a type of storage that is a bit more efficient than network attached storage.
